Asteroid mining firm prepares for historic deep space mission with help of Elon Musk's SpaceX

IndiaTimes Thursday, 19 October 2023
Astroforge, a California-based company, is creating a spacecraft called Brokkr-2 with the goal of commercializing space mining. The spacecraft will be launched alongside a drill to the Moon's surface as part of the Artemis program. The successful test firing of the rockets that will propel the spacecraft to an asteroid destination marks a crucial milestone.
